5.2.6 Connections to connectors (option)
Location of con-
nectors
The industrial connectors can be found on the front of the control cabinet. See the figure
below and the figure in section "Control cabinet connections manipulator"!
The manipulator arm is equipped with round Burndy/Framatome connectors (customer con-
nector not included).

Connectors,
description
Each industrial connector has accomodations for four rows of 16 conductors with a maximum
conductor area of 1.5 mm
2
. The pull-relief clamp must be used when connecting the shield
to the case.
Making the con-
nection
The section below details how to crimp cable connections to pins:
1. Using a special crimp tool, crimp a pin or socket on to each non-insulated conduc-
tor.
When two conductors are be connected to the same pin or socket, both of them must be
crimped into the same pin or socket. A maximum of two conductors may be crimped into
the same pin or socket.
2. Snap the pin into the connector housing.
3. Push the pin into the connector until it locks.
4. When removing pins or sockets from industrial connectors, a special extractor
tool must be used.
